The USB Media Ports and the 12Vdc outlets are on two seperate fused circuits. They do have a common tie in at the Power Distribution Center Assembly (Fuse Box). That PDC though is more than just a wired fuse box and has integrated electronic circuitry to it.

There is no magic bullet other than having a schematic and checking powers and grounds. If under the 3/36K warranty, I would let the dealer deal with it.

The radio does get power from the PDC. However, certain functions of the radio are fused in the BCM. Apple carplay, USB power are also powered through the BCM. Any chance you could have someone pull the codes on the BCM? Is this part of load shedding is what I am wondering? Anything else not working?

Battery Below 12.2v will start load shedding. I can't tell what is being load shed at this point but a " battery Saver on " message would be displayed on the IPC. You might want to scroll through the screens there to look for that message.

11.8v is the critical stage and at 10 9v heated seats and steering wheel are shed along with hvac controls and only emergency audio is allowed.
